Output 23e40cf62abf4c44db2d05719c9f3671fdf03aff6f1c34bb0504e84705ebc7ca:0

value
10275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b2038f064d6a2757b2c879d46c61ea2bfd2291 OP_EQUAL
address
3LdD3sitaihQ33DGV1twQkY7rjdzAT7Aat
transaction
23e40cf62abf4c44db2d05719c9f3671fdf03aff6f1c34bb0504e84705ebc7ca
spent
true